Released in 2014, Fetty Wap’s "Trap Queen" was an instant cultural monolith, blending the grit of Paterson, New Jersey's drug trade with the sweetness of a genuine love song. However, in the modern digital landscape, the track has found a second, hyper-energetic life through . Often associated with the "nightcore" aesthetic or TikTok trends, these versions condense the original's melodic trap bounce into a high-octane earworm. The Anatomy of the Sped-Up Remix
